Управління Internet Explorer через реєстр, Різне, Інтернет-технології, статті

 

Збереження сторінок

В Internet Explorer існує можливість зберігати веб-сторінки повністю, з усіма картинками і скриптами, що знаходяться в документі. Крім того, існує спосіб відключити цю можливість. Для цього достатньо змінити значення параметра в реєстрі. “0” – можливість збереження включена, “1” – відключена.





REGEDIT4
[HKEY_CURRENT_USERSoftwarePoliciesMicrosoftInternet ExplorerInfodeliveryRestrictions]”NoBrowserSaveWebComplete”=dword:00000001





Зміна логотипу Internet Explorer

Анімований логотип Internet Explorer, що знаходиться у правому верхньому кутку вікна, можна змінити на свій власний. Для цього потрібно створити 2 малюнки в форматі bmp. Кожен малюнок являє собою послідовність квадратних кадрів і в підсумку є анімованим. У першого малюнка розмір кадру 38×38, у другого – 26×26. Тобто якщо розмір першого малюнка складає 38×380, то він складається з 10 послідовних вертикальних кадрів. Після створення малюнків шляху до них потрібно записати в параметри в реєстрі Windows.





REGEDIT4
[HKEY_CURRENT_USERSoftwareMicrosoftInternet ExplorerToolbar]
“BrandBitmap”=”C:WindowsImageBig.bmp”
“SmBrandBitmap”=”C:WindowsImageSmall.bmp”



Стандартні сторінки Internet Explorer

В Internet Explorer 5.0 практично всі стандартні сторінки (наприклад, “Про програму”, або “Сервер не знайдено”) зберігаються в HTML коді в бібліотеці SHDOCLC.DLL в папці [C: WindowsSystem]. Ці сторінки можна змінювати, але за умови, що між кожними двома тегами має бути фіксована кількість символів, тобто, якщо зі сторінки “Сервер не знайдений” ви прибрали 250 символів тексту (це цілком можливо, так як код там неоптимізованих), то стільки ж повинні додати (в принципі, можна у вигляді коментарів). Перехід рядка вважається за 2 символи.



Запуск IE в режимі автономної роботи

У реєстрі є ключ, який відповідає за те, чи буде Internet Explorer завжди працювати в автономному режимі. “0” – запуск в будь-якому режимі, “1” – запуск тільки в режимі автономної роботи. При цьому, якщо встановлено значення “1”, пункт “Автономна робота” в меню “Файл” Internet Explorer буде ігноруватися.





REGEDIT4
[H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rent VersionInternet Settings]
“GlobalUserOffline”=dword:00000001



Зміна пошукової сторінки

Для того щоб змінити стандартну пошукову сторінку Internet Explorer, потрібно прописати її адресу в параметрі в реєстрі.





REGEDIT4
[HKEY_CURRENT_USERSoftwareMicrosoftInternet ExplorerMain]
“Search Page”=”http://www.ya.ru”



Пароль “Радника по вмісту”

Пароль “Радника по вмісту” зберігається в реєстрі в зашифрованому вигляді. Однак, щоб зняти пароль, достатньо просто видалити параметр або очистити його вміст.





REGEDIT4
[HKEY_LOCAL_MACHINESoftwareMicrosoftWindowsCurrentVersionPoliciesRatings]
“Key”=-



Таймаут відповіді сервера

В Internet Explorer є можливість змінити час очікування (таймаут) відповіді сервера на запит. Для цього потрібно змінити значення параметра в реєстрі. Час вказується в мілісекундах, значення за замовчуванням – “300000”, тобто 5 хвилин.





REGEDIT4
[H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ionInternet Settings]
“ReceiveTimeout”=dword:400000



Аліаси сайтів і файлів

В Internet Explorer є можливість створювати аліаси (вигадані імена, aliases) сайтам і файлів. Для цього потрібно помістити посилання на сайт в меню “Вибране” і в якості назви ярлика вказати аліас. При цьому можуть виникати нестандартні ситуації:

  • При введенні адреси відкривається інша сторінка. Це відбувається, якщо один з аліасів збігається з реальним адресою сайту. Так, наприклад, якщо створити посилання на сторінку www.yandex.ru і назвати її “km.ru”, то при введенні в адресному рядку браузера “km.ru” ви потрапите на Яндекс.
  • При введенні адреси відкривається сторінка або файл, хоча в папці “Вибране” аліасів немає. Це відбувається, якщо введений адреса збігається з ім’ям якого-небудь файлу, що знаходиться на “Робочому столі”. В цьому випадку ситуація аналогічна попередній.



    Запуск Internet Explorer в режимі Провідника
    Для того щоб запустити Explorer в режимі Провідника (з деревом каталогів), досить запустити його в параметром-e. Наприклад, команда “iexplore-ec: d” відкриє папку [C: d] в режимі провідника.



    Запуск Internet Explorer в повноекранному режимі

    Для того, щоб відкрити Internet Explorer в повноекранному режимі (ще більшому, ніж при натисканні F11), його необхідно запустити з параметром-k. Так, наприклад, команда “iexplore-k http://www.windows.sl.ru” відкриє сайт http://www.windows.sl.ru. Так як в цьому режимі повністю відсутні будь кнопки навігації, необхідно знати гарячі клавіші
    .

    Кеш
    Сповільнити роботу браузера в Інтернеті може великий кеш. Для браузера Internet Explorer він зберігається в папці Windows, в папці “Temporary Internet Files”, а регулюється він так: запустіть Internet Explorer, зайдіть в “Сервіс-Властивості оглядача” в меню і натисніть на кнопку “Налаштування” у формі “Тимчасові файли Інтернету” на вкладці “Загальні”. Для Інтернет-акселератора NetSonic потрібно зайти в “NetSonic Options” і на вкладці “Settings” натиснути на кнопку “Advanced Cache”.



    Провідник як два окремих процесу
    Як всім відомо, Explorer (Провідник) виступає і в якості оболонки Windows, і в якісно файл-менеджера. І хоча це підвищує зручність, на використанні пам’яті це позначається аж ніяк не кращим чином. При нормальних умовах Провідник віднімає цілих 8 Мбайт пам’яті Windows через проблеми з виділенням пам’яті – Windows використовує подвійну квоту пам’яті для Провідника, вважаючи її використовуваної різними програмами. Щоб позбутися від цієї проблеми, “інтегрованої” в систему, треба запустити Провідник як два окремих процесу замість одного. Для цього потрібно змінити значення параметра в реєстрі. “0” – один процес, “1” – два процеси.




    REGEDIT4
    [H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ionExplorerAdvanced]
    SeparateProcess=dword:00000001


    Як відкривати Windows Explorer при відкритті папки “Мій комп’ютер”
    Для того щоб включити можливість запускати Windows Explorer при відкритті папки “Мій комп’ютер” потрібно виконати дві речі. Перше – змінити значення параметра в реєстрі на “Explorer”. Друге – створити параметр із значенням “explorer.exe / e, / n, :: {20D04FE0-3AEA-1069-A2D8-08002B30309D}”.




    REGEDIT4
    [HKEY_CLASSES_ROOTCLSID{20D04FE0-3AEA-1069-A2D8-08002B30309D}shell] @=”Explorer”
    [HKEY_CLASSES_ROOTCLSID{20D04FE0-3AEA-1069-A2D8-08002B30309D}shellExplorerCommand]
    @=”explorer.exe /e,/n,::{20D04FE0-3AEA-1069-A2D8-08002B30309D}”

    Для того щоб повернути все на свої місця потрібно задати значення параметра рівним “None”, а потім видалити ключ в реєстрі:




    REGEDIT4
    [HKEY_CLASSES_ROOTCLSID{20D04FE0-3AEA-1069-A2D8-08002B30309D}shell]
    @=”None”
    [-HKEY_CLASSES_ROOTCLSID{20D04FE0-3AEA-1069-A2D8-08002B30309D}shellExplorer]


    Оновлення вмісту вікна Провідника
    У Windows існує можливість оновлювати вікно Провідника не по натисненню кнопки, а автоматично. За це відповідає параметр в реєстрі. “0” – вікно оновлюється автоматично, “1” – вікно оновлюється по натисненню кнопки.




    REGEDIT4
    [HKEY_LOCAL_MACHINESystemCurrentControlSetControlUpdate]
    “UpdateMode”=dword:00000000


    Перезавантаження при помилках оболонки
    За замовчуванням при помилках оболонки (Explorer) перезавантажується вся операціоннная система. Однак, існує можливість перезавантажувати тільки саму оболонку, тим самим не втрачаючи даних, які обробляються іншими додатками. “0” – перезавантажується операційна система, “1” – перезавантажується тільки оболонка.







    REGEDIT4
    [HKEY_CURRENT_USERSoftwareMicrosoftWindows NTCurrentVersionWinlogon]
    “AutoRestartShell”=dword:00000001
  • Схожі статті:


    Сподобалася стаття? Ви можете залишити відгук або підписатися на RSS , щоб автоматично отримувати інформацію про нові статтях.

    Коментарів поки що немає.

    Ваш отзыв

    Поділ на параграфи відбувається автоматично, адреса електронної пошти ніколи не буде опублікований, допустимий HT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

    *

    *